2020-08-18 12:43发布
加入QQ群:457200227(SAP S4 HANA技术交流) 群内免费提供SAP练习系统(在群公告中)
嗨,
我正在尝试通过WebIDE(完整堆栈)将自定义UI5应用程序部署到SCP,但是由于ES6 JS代码而在构建期间失败。
删除ES6代码并替换为ES5意味着构建可以正常进行,没有任何问题。
也许会丑化问题? 构建控制台日志不是很清楚。
干杯
詹姆斯
>也许是丑陋的问题?
是的,请参见 https://stackoverflow .com/a/52841062 进行解释。
更新:从" @ sap/grunt-sapui5-bestpractice-build":" 1.3.65"开始,不再需要以下解决方法 !
________ 更早的答案:
现在,您可以在 package.json 中添加" grunt-openui5":" 0.15.0" >文件,以便使用ES6语法进行部署。
{ "名称": "...", " version":" 0.0.1", " description":" ...", "私人":是的, " devDependencies":{ " @ sap/grunt-sapui5-bestpractice-build":" 1.3.62", " grunt-openui5":" 0.15.0" } }
要检查grunt-openui5的最新版本,请运行:
npm查看grunt-openui5
,或者只需访问以下 npm页面。
Web IDE现在支持在1.3.65或更高版本中使用ES6语法进行部署。 @ sap/grunt-sapui5-bestpractice-build已应用。 相应地更新了我的 answer 。
由于此问题现已正式解决(没有解决方法) ),我建议关闭这个问题。
嗨詹姆斯,
您是否已完成此博客? 还有一个简化的博客仅处理jlint错误此处。
最诚挚的问候,伊万
在此博客中。 Ivan引用了此博客,其中基本上包含三个简单步骤。
最多设置5个标签!
>也许是丑陋的问题?
是的,请参见 https://stackoverflow .com/a/52841062 进行解释。
更新:从" @ sap/grunt-sapui5-bestpractice-build":" 1.3.65"开始,不再需要以下解决方法 !
________
更早的答案:
现在,您可以在 package.json 中添加" grunt-openui5":" 0.15.0" >文件,以便使用ES6语法进行部署。
要检查grunt-openui5的最新版本,请运行:
,或者只需访问以下 npm页面。
Web IDE现在支持在1.3.65或更高版本中使用ES6语法进行部署。 @ sap/grunt-sapui5-bestpractice-build已应用。 相应地更新了我的 answer 。
由于此问题现已正式解决(没有解决方法) ),我建议关闭这个问题。
嗨詹姆斯,
您是否已完成此博客? 还有一个简化的博客仅处理jlint错误此处。
最诚挚的问候,
伊万
在此博客中。
Ivan引用了此博客,其中基本上包含三个简单步骤。
一周热门 更多>